Abstract:Match Liquidity, a trading name of Match Liquidity DMCC, is allegedly a financial technology solution and liquidity provider registered in United Arab Emirates that claims to provide its clients with a web-based ML Trader trading platform.

Match Liquidity DMCC is an established proprietary trading firm. It provides various market instruments including Cash stocks, CFDs, fixed income, FX, oil, gas, commodities, futures and options and ETFs.

You can check it on the WiKiFX's official website: Match Liquidity is currently not subject to any regulation.

You can trade dozens of products including Cash stocks, CFDs, fixed income, FX, oil, gas, commodities, futures and options and ETFs.

Match Liquidity DMCC supports pricing and trading functionality on multiple established trading platforms, including its custom multi-asset trading platform Global Trader and Meta Quotes MT4 and MT5.
